Product Description

The Bently Nevada 330101-00-08-10-02-05 3300 XL 8 mm Proximity Probe is a high-precision sensor designed to measure the relative distance between the probe tip and a conductive surface, typically the shaft of rotating machinery. As part of the highly regarded 3300 XL Series, this proximity probe is engineered for outstanding reliability, superior measurement accuracy, and resistance to harsh industrial environments.

The 3300 XL 8 mm series has become an industry standard for shaft vibration and position measurements, offering a high degree of interchangeability and compatibility with the broader Bently Nevada 3300 systems. It is commonly deployed in critical turbomachinery protection systems where precise measurement is vital for early fault detection and machinery health management.

Applications

The Bently Nevada 330101-00-08-10-02-05 Proximity Probe is widely used across industries requiring the continuous monitoring of rotating machinery:

  • Turbines – Monitoring shaft vibration and radial displacement in steam and gas turbines.

  • Compressors – Detecting shaft movement, imbalance, and mechanical looseness.

  • Motors and Generators – Shaft positioning and bearing condition monitoring.

  • Gearboxes – Monitoring gear shaft behavior to detect misalignment or wear.

  • Pumps – Measuring shaft movement to diagnose impeller imbalance or bearing faults.

  • Fans and Blowers – Identifying excessive vibration or shaft rubbing conditions.

Its reliable performance in extreme conditions makes it indispensable in sectors such as oil and gas, petrochemical processing, power generation, and heavy manufacturing industries.

Frequently Asked Questions (FAQs)

  1. What machines are best suited for the 330101-00-08-10-02-05 probe?

    It is ideal for use on critical turbomachinery like turbines, compressors, and large motors.

  2. Can this probe be used with non-Bently Nevada proximity systems?

    It is optimized for use with Bently Nevada 3300 series Proximitor Sensors and monitoring systems.

  3. Is the 8-meter cable length adjustable?

    No, the cable is factory installed and should not be cut or altered to ensure accuracy and integrity.

  4. What is the minimum bend radius for the extension cable?

    The minimum bend radius is 50 mm (2 inches) to prevent cable damage.

  5. Can this probe operate continuously at high temperatures?

    Yes, it is designed for continuous operation at temperatures up to 177°C (350°F).

  6. Does the probe need periodic recalibration?

    Recalibration is rarely needed; however, system verification during scheduled shutdowns is recommended.

  7. What kind of connector is used at the probe end?

    It uses a micro-dot coaxial connector, ensuring reliable signal transmission.

  8. Is the probe resistant to oil and moisture exposure?

    Yes, its stainless-steel body and PPS tip material provide excellent resistance to industrial contaminants.

  9. Can the probe be mounted horizontally or vertically?

    Yes, the probe orientation is flexible and depends on machinery requirements.

  10. How is probe performance verified after installation?

    Performance is verified using a micrometer gap tool and observing the corresponding voltage output.
